日常开发中,经常会处理开发环境、测试环境、生产环境的配置文件,一旦项目大了之后各种配置文件太多,每次修改配置文件切换各种环境时容易遗漏,解决方案可以使用maven配置profile来实现,修改pom.xml如下: 1、新增profiles,与build同级 2、指定resource 然后在项目的re ...
分类:
其他好文 时间:
2017-11-09 14:38:13
阅读次数:
224
今天在IDEA中使用Maven和Scala新建项目,没有自动产生src ,而且一直显示在下载文件,百度了一下,应该是国内的网速限制了到Maven的访问。 解决: 在创建项目的这一步时,加一句下面的参数 name: archetypeCatalogvallue: internal 如图(懒得截图,直接 ...
分类:
其他好文 时间:
2017-11-08 20:06:22
阅读次数:
197
1、背景: 主项目maven工程依赖于其他两个maven工程,由于依赖的两个maven工程自动生成的jar包无法通过pom中dependency 并且生成的jar包无法导入tomcat下webapps中相应项目的lib目录,导致项目启动,报找不到类异常。 2、解决方法: 目前是把别人启动tomcat ...
分类:
其他好文 时间:
2017-11-08 11:56:45
阅读次数:
119
由于一些eclipse版本问题,mybatis的mapper包中的sql文件没有被打进包,需要在pom中加入: <build> <!--配置打包时不过滤非java文件开始 --> <!--说明,在进行模块化开发打jar包时,maven会将非java文件过滤掉, xml,properties配置文件等 ...
分类:
移动开发 时间:
2017-11-06 19:10:38
阅读次数:
375
Maven内置变量说明: ${basedir} 项目根目录 ${project.build.directory} 构建目录,缺省为target ${project.build.outputDirectory} 构建过程输出目录,缺省为target/classes ${project.build.fi ...
分类:
其他好文 时间:
2017-11-06 15:56:35
阅读次数:
145
首先要确定settings.xml配置路径正确 (下面是我自己的路径,设置自己的路径) 用客户端暴力解决方法: 1)把本地中工作空间中内容删除重新下载 2)导入到eclipse中 会出现一些问题 右键—》import—》Maven—>Other...—》import—》 导入的工作空间 添加完成,有 ...
分类:
系统相关 时间:
2017-11-06 14:59:51
阅读次数:
155
Maven的安装 一、下载 下载好后 二、解压及安装 三、配置 四、完成 ...
分类:
其他好文 时间:
2017-11-04 11:12:49
阅读次数:
152
1. 问题 看到这个错误以为是貌似jsp页面有误,c:forTokens标签用错了?? 但是测试和预生产环境没有出现该问题,是否环境有问题? 2. 解决方法 在网上看到有说jstl.jar冲突的,在项目lib中确实有jstl1.2.jar但是tomcat的lib库及jdk的lib库中均没有改jar; ...
分类:
移动开发 时间:
2017-11-03 11:24:32
阅读次数:
325
在平时的开发中,我们往往不会使用默认的中央仓库,默认的中央仓库访问的速度比较慢,访问的人或许很多,有时候也无法满足我们项目的需求,可能项目需要的某些构件中央仓库中是没有的,而在其他远程仓库中有,如JBoss Maven仓库。这时,可以在pom.xml中配置该仓库,代码如下 ...
分类:
其他好文 时间:
2017-11-02 21:13:22
阅读次数:
128
<mirror> <id>nexus-aliyun</id> <mirrorOf>*</mirrorOf> <name>Nexus aliyun</name> <url>http://maven.aliyun.com/nexus/content/groups/public</url> </mirro ...
分类:
其他好文 时间:
2017-10-31 22:21:29
阅读次数:
124